Potentiometer is a kind of variable resistor, usually composed of a resistor and a rotating or sliding system, that is, by a moving contact to move on the resistor to obtain part of the voltage output.
Classification of potentiometers
According to the different materials required by its resistance body, potentiometers can be divided into carbon film potentiometers, metal film potentiometers, carbon solid potentiometers, organic solid potentiometers, wire-wound potentiometers, glass glaze potentiometers, etc.
According to its structure, potentiometers can be divided into single-coil, multi-coil potentiometers, single-coupling, double-coupling coaxial potentiometers, with switching potentiometers, locking and non-locking potentiometers. According to the adjustment mode, it is divided into rotary potentiometer and straight sliding potentiometer.
Parameters of potentiometer
The main parameters of potentiometer are nominal resistance, rated power, resolution, sliding noise, resistance change characteristics, wear resistance, zero resistance and temperature coefficient. In addition to the same parameters as the resistor, there are the following parameters.
1. Variation of resistance value
Potentiometer is divided into linear potentiometer, exponential potentiometer and logarithmic potentiometer according to the law of resistance change with contact when adjusting.
(1) The resistance value of the linear potentiometer changes linearly and uniformly with the movement of the sliding end. It is generally indicated by the character "X" and is suitable for the adjustment of partial pressure and bias flow.
(2) The resistance value of the logarithmic potentiometer changes logarithmically with the movement of the sliding end. It is generally represented by the character "D" and is suitable for the tone control of radios, audio systems, etc.
(3) The resistance value of the exponential potentiometer changes exponentially with the movement of the sliding end. It is generally represented by the character "Z" and is suitable for volume control of radios, stereos, etc.
2. Dynamic noise
Due to the uneven distribution of resistance values and the existence of sliding contact resistance, the sliding arm of the potentiometer generates noise when the resistance body moves. This noise will have a bad effect on electronic equipment.

Measurement of potentiometer
1. Potentiometer nominal resistance measurement
The potentiometer has three lead pieces: two end pieces and a center tap contact piece. When measuring the nominal resistance value, select the appropriate range of the multimeter ohm stop, put the two pens of the multimeter on the two ends of the potentiometer, and the resistance value indicated by the multimeter pointer is the nominal resistance value of the potentiometer.
2. Performance measurement
Performance measurement mainly measures whether the center tap contact plate of the potentiometer is in good contact with the resistance body. When measuring, rotate the center contact piece of the potentiometer to any end of the potentiometer, select the appropriate range of the multimeter ohm stop, put a pen of the multimeter on any piece of the two ends of the potentiometer, and put another pen on the center tap contact piece of the potentiometer. At this point, the reading on the multimeter should be the nominal value of the potentiometer or 0. Then slowly rotate the potentiometer knob to the other end, the multimeter reading will continuously decrease from the nominal value or continuously rise from 0 as the potentiometer knob rotates until it drops to zero or rises to the nominal resistance value.
In the process of rotating the potentiometer knob, the pointer of the multimeter should slide up or down smoothly, no jumping or jumping phenomenon, and the rotating inch potentiometer does not feel too loose or too tight.
In the test potentiometer is good or bad, the main requirement is that the resistance value meets the requirements; Second, the contact between the central sliding end and the resistance body is good, and the rotation is smooth. For a potentiometer with a switch, the switch part should be accurate, reliable and flexible. Therefore, the potentiometer performance must be checked before use.
